The Mercedes-Benz EQS SUV and Tesla Version X stand out in the high-end electrical SUV market, yet their efficiency and efficiency profiles cater to various top priorities. In comparison, the Tesla Model X, readily available in base and Plaid variants, provides up to 670 hp and a blistering 2.5-second 0-60 mph in the Plaid, making it an efficiency titan.
The Tesla Model X flaunts an EPA-estimated range of up to 348 miles, outpacing the EQS SUV's 305-mile optimum. The EQS shines with its Intelligent Energy Recuperation system, using 3 modes to maximize recovery, and ECO Assist, which leverages navigating and chauffeur help information to improve performance.
For purchasers, it's a selection in between Tesla's rate and range or Mercedes-Benz's balanced efficiency and clever efficiency. The EQS SUV prioritizes a smooth, controlled trip, while the Model X presses the limits of electrical velocity.
